Yugoslav Spomeniks (Part 4-B): Serbia's Most Beautiful Towns & Villages

23. October - 5. November 2022. Serbia (Србија) ???????? This 4th chapter video presents the second half of my 10-day Autumn round-trip drive from Vršac around the most beautiful parts of Serbia for 1,117 miles (1,978 km) looking for Yugoslav-era spomeniks (monuments). I found (26) of them. The spomeniks are mainly World War II memorial sculptures that were part of a grand project of Tito's to unify socialist Yugoslavia in the aftermath of the NOB. Estimates put the number of such spomeniks built at up to 40,000. These communist works of art are unique and beautiful and often abandoned.

The towns / areas I rolled through are (Part 4-A) Topola (Топола), Paraćin (Параћин), Kruševac (Крушевац) (Slobodište Memorial Complex), Retanj (Ртањ) in the Serbian Carpathians, Knjaževac (Књажевац), Štrbac (Штрбац), Pirot (Пирот), Stara Planina Villages of Donja Kamenica (Доња Каменица), Gostuša (Гостуша), & Rsovci (Рсовци), Niš (Ниш), Donja Lokošnica (Доња Локошница) AKA World's Red Pepper Capital, Kopaonik (Копаоник) (Mramor Monument), Novi Pazar (Нови Пазар), (Part 4-B) Novi Pazar (Нови Пазар), Sjenica, (Сјеница), Prijepolje (Пријепоље), Zlatibor (Златибор), Mokra Gora (Мокра Гора), Tara National Park (Brno Borova Memorial Site), Perućac (Перућац), Obrenovac (Обреновац), Vršac (Вршац), Banatski Karlovac (Банатски Карловац).

Obrenovac (Serbia tourism)

Obrenovac mesto pored Beograda koji lezi na dve reke, Savi i Kolubari. Zauzima površinu od 40.995 ha, na kojoj živi 74 460 stanovnika. Do 20. veka nosio je naziv Palež, jer je više puta, poslednji put tokom Drugog srpskog ustanka potpuno spaljivan, a 1859. obnavlja ga knez Miloš Obrenović, po kome dobija naziv. Opština Obrenovac je uključena u zajednicu beogradskih opština od 1957.
Dan opštine je 20. decembar, dan ukaza kneza Miloša Obrenovića kojim je ustanovljen naziv Obrenovac, a krsna slava Svete Trojice.
U Obrenovcu se nalaze dve termoelektrane Nikola Tesla A i Nikola Tesla B, koje proizvode više od 60 procenata električnih potreba Srbije. Ali i izletiste Zabran i Banju sumporne vode.

Day Drinking with Serbians on a Floating House | Serbian Rakia

-ENGLISH-
Hello everyone. In this week's video, my Turkish friend Melike and I spend a day with the Serbians in a Splav house, a Belgrade classic. I feel very lucky to have such a day because what I enjoy most while traveling is to experience the lifestyle of the local people.

Splav is the name given by the locals to the houses floating on the river. There are many splav houses lined up side by side on the Sava river. It is also an excellent place for many water sports activities.
